Cost to Run a Humidifier in Ohio
Ohio's average residential electricity rate is 19.5¢/kWh as of April 2026 — the 35th cheapest in the country, 4% above the U.S. average. At typical usage (10 hours/day), a humidifier here costs $2.37 per month.

By usage level in Ohio
| Usage | Per day | Per month | Per year |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light (5 hrs/day) | 3.9¢ | $1.19 | $14.24 |
| Typical (10 hrs/day) | 7.8¢ | $2.37 | $28.47 |
| Heavy (20 hrs/day) | $0.16 | $4.74 | $56.94 |

Frequently asked questions
How much does it cost to run a humidifier in Ohio?
At Ohio's current average residential rate of 19.5¢/kWh (April 2026), a humidifier with typical usage costs about 7.8¢ per day, $2.37 per month, or $28.47 per year.
Is running a humidifier in Ohio more expensive than average?
Yes. Ohio's electricity costs about 4% more than the U.S. average, so the same usage costs $2.37 per month here versus $2.29 nationally.
What does electricity cost in Ohio right now?
Ohio residents pay an average of 19.5¢ per kWh as of April 2026 — the 35th cheapest rate of the 51 U.S. jurisdictions we track.
